RF Energy Harvesting - Review of e-Peas 2.4 GHz energy harvesting evaluation board

Is RF energy harvesting viable to power an IoT sensor? Vast armies of sensors are crucial to feeding IIoT monitoring and analysis applications. Powering these edge nodes is increasingly a channel. Even though modern microcontrollers exhibit ultra-low power consumption characteristics, a battery would need to be replaced at some stage, the total cost of which is typically more than the sensor. Provisioning line/mains power infrastructure is equally expensive. How about energy harvesting? Could this provide a viable power source? What about harvesting ambient RF energy? In this video, we investigate the potential for powering IIoT sensors using this approach.
